Underload
Definition
1) Underload: A situation where a person or system is not being utilized to its full capacity, resulting in a lack of sufficient workload or activity.
2) Underload: The state of having too few demands or pressures placed on a person, often leading to boredom, low motivation, or underperformance.
3) Underload: A condition where a machine, engine, or system is not being used at its full capacity, causing inefficiency or limited productivity.
